This gorgeous stone townhouse, close to the heart of Alnwick, is ideal for friends or families looking for a restful holiday and a perfect base for exploring the Northumberland coast and countryside. Wander through the market town from your doorstep, browsing the shops and admiring Alnwick Garden and the magnificent castle. Warkworth village, with its must-see Castle Street brimming with eateries and galleries, and the majestic castle at the top, is only 7.5 miles away. Warkworth Beach is less than 300 metres from the village, offering a tranquil spot for walks and water sports, plus views of Alnmouth and Coquet Island.

Step into the lobby of this stylish two-storey cottage, then wander on through the beautiful, stained-glass door to the main reception hall. The interior combines original features, lovely decor, and a nod to both mid-20th-century design and the Arts and Crafts movement. The open-plan lounge/diner invites you to unwind on the L-shaped sofa while watching TV. Continue through to the dining area to light the crackling wood burner and savour holiday feasts. The galley-style kitchen features all the appliances needed to easily prepare meals. Upstairs are a chic family bathroom and three elegant bedrooms: one super-king-size with a TV, one double, and one single (with an additional pull-out single bed). Outside, relax in the enclosed rear courtyard with outdoor furniture, or in the front garden, both offering ideal spots for morning coffee. Parking is on-street and subject to availability.

Discover hidden gems along the scenic Northumberland coast. Stroll across the sand at Alnmouth (4.5 miles), or picnic at beautiful Beadnell Bay Beach (3.5 miles), with its breathtaking views. Alternatively, head to the pretty village of Amble (10 miles) and board an island boat trip to see the puffins.
